I used my freedom on the 4th to relax in my card room and created this Wedding Card, already on its way to California to Drew and Tish Pletcher, my cousin's son and bride! I hope you enjoy.







I chose Core'dinations Cardmaker Series, Lavender Pearls cardstock for the layers along with Image+ cardstock in White.

Layers were die cut with SIZZIX BIG KICK using SPELLBINDERS NESTABILITIES, MAJESTIC ELEMENTS, RADIANT RECTANGLES. I used Wax Paper with die cuts to easily remove them when cut. (What a HUGE help this is!)

Card was edged with PAN , Violet, #470.5

I used my SCOTCH ATG with Adhesive from Scotch and ZIG 2-Way Glue, as well as Pop Dots for layering. 

Inside sentiment is a stamp from STAMPIN' UP stamped with MOMENTO black ink and embossed with RANGER Clear embossing powder. 

Embellishments are a sequin strand from STYLIT SEQUINS (SEQUINS INTERNATIONAL INC.)and Pearls both from Pat Catans.

I love my ENVELOPE PUNCH BOARD by WeR Memory Makers. This valuable tool allows me to create many, many sized envelopes using cardstock on hand! I embellished the front with pieces cut from one of the layers of the Nesties!
